The best option depends on how much gear you have, how many people are traveling, and how rugged you want your dive days to be.<\/p>\n<h3>Economy cars and sedans<\/h3>\n<p>For solo travelers or couples packing light, an <a href=\"https:\/\/www.bonairerentacar.com\/nl\/2026\/04\/25\/guide-to-bonaire-rental-classes\/\">economy car or sedan<\/a> can be enough. If you are renting tanks locally and keeping your setup simple, these smaller vehicles are easier to park and can be budget-friendly. They work well for paved roads, resort stays, and a mix of diving and town trips.<\/p>\n<p>The trade-off is space. Once you add fins, mesh bags, towels, and a cooler, a small trunk fills up quickly. If you are carrying underwater camera equipment or want room to keep wet and dry items separated, a compact car may feel tight by day two.<\/p>\n<h3>SUVs and pickups<\/h3>\n<p>For many divers, this is the sweet spot. An SUV or pickup gives you more room for gear, easier loading, and a better fit for the practical rhythm of Bonaire diving. If you are doing multiple shore dives in a day, that extra cargo space matters. It can be the difference between tossing gear in comfortably and playing luggage Tetris in a parking area.<\/p>\n<p>Pickups are especially popular with divers because they make gear handling simple. Tanks and wet items can ride in the back, and the cabin stays cleaner and drier. That said, open cargo space is not ideal for every item. If you are traveling with expensive camera gear or anything that should stay out of the sun, you will want to plan where those items go.<\/p>\n<h3>Larger and specialty vehicles<\/h3>\n<p>If you are traveling with family, another couple, or a bigger group, more capacity can save a lot of hassle. A larger SUV or pickup gives everyone more elbow room and keeps the trip from feeling crowded before you even reach the water.<\/p>\n<p>Specialty vehicles can also make sense if your plans go beyond standard beach access. Some travelers want a car that feels ready for rougher roads and all-day island exploring, not just a quick drive to the nearest entry point. That choice is often less about style and more about how much freedom you want in your itinerary.<\/p>\n<h2>What divers should think about before they book<\/h2>\n<p>It helps to be honest about how you travel, not just how you hope to travel. That is one reason many visitors choose Bonaire Rent a Car &#8211; the process is simple, the fleet choices are practical, and the service is built around the way people actually move around the island.<\/p>\n<h2>Common mistakes divers make when renting a car<\/h2>\n<p>The biggest one is booking too small. It is easy to think, We are only two people, so any car will do. But two divers with gear can fill a vehicle fast, and cramped space gets old quickly on a weeklong trip.<\/p>\n<p>Another mistake is choosing based only on price. Budget matters, of course, but so does usability. A slightly cheaper car that does not fit your tanks, towels, and day bags is not really the better value.<\/p>\n<p>Some travelers also forget to factor in the rest of the vacation. If you are mixing diving with beach hopping, dinners out, grocery runs, and sightseeing, your car needs to support all of it. A vehicle should fit the full trip, not just the first morning dive.<\/p>\n<p>Lastly, people sometimes leave booking too late. Bonaire attracts a lot of repeat divers who know exactly what vehicle they want. Reserving early gives you better odds of getting the right class instead of settling.<\/p>\n<h2>A better rental experience starts with the right expectations<\/h2>\n<p>A good dive rental car does not need to feel fancy.
